.secure-program{padding:0 112px}.secure-program.table{margin:0 auto;max-width:1680px;padding:120px 40px}@media (max-width:1259px){.secure-program.table{margin:unset;max-width:unset;padding:120px 0}}@media (max-width:767px){.secure-program.table{padding:80px 16px}.secure-program.table h1{font-size:31px;font-weight:500;line-height:120%}}.secure-program.table table{border:1.5px solid #384141;border-collapse:separate}.secure-program.table tr:first-child,.secure-program.table tr:nth-child(2){background:#2f3737}@media (max-width:1259px){.secure-program.table{max-width:100vw}.secure-program.table table{display:block;overflow:hidden;width:-moz-fit-content;width:fit-content}}.secure-program.table .q-tab__content{width:100%}.secure-program.table .content-block .block{max-width:100%;width:100%}@media (max-width:1023px){.secure-program.table .content-block .block{margin-left:-16px;margin-right:-16px;max-width:calc(100% + 32px);overflow:scroll;padding-left:16px;padding-right:16px;width:calc(100% + 32px)}.secure-program.table .content-block .block .table{min-width:800px;overflow:scroll}}.secure-program.table .content-block .block tbody td,.secure-program.table .content-block .block td,.secure-program.table .content-block .block thead th,.secure-program.table .content-block .block tr:first-child td{border:1.5px solid #384141;color:#dbdbdb;font-size:24px;font-style:normal;font-weight:500;height:80px!important;line-height:26px;padding:12px 40px 12px 24px;vertical-align:middle;width:125px}@media (max-width:1023px){.secure-program.table .content-block .block tbody td,.secure-program.table .content-block .block td,.secure-program.table .content-block .block thead th,.secure-program.table .content-block .block tr:first-child td{font-size:20px;font-weight:500;height:50px!important;line-height:120%;padding:12px 8px}}.secure-program.table .content-block .block td,.secure-program.table .content-block .block th{text-align:center}.secure-program.table .content-block .block td:first-child,.secure-program.table .content-block .block th:first-child{text-align:left;width:512px}.secure-program.table .content-block .block table{background:#252c2c;border-radius:16px;height:auto!important;width:100%}.secure-program.table .content-block .block thead{background:#2f3737;border-radius:16px 16px 0 0}@media (max-width:1259px){.secure-program.table .content-block .block thead:first-child{grid-area:title}}.secure-program.table .content-block .block thead:first-child th:first-child{border-top-left-radius:16px}.secure-program.table .content-block .block thead:first-child th:last-child{border-top-right-radius:16px}.secure-program.table .content-block .block thead th{background:#2f3737}.secure-program.table .tab-top-image{height:195px;width:100%}.secure-program.table .tab-top-image .q-img{height:100%;max-height:100%;max-width:100%;width:100%}@media (max-width:1259px){.secure-program{padding:0 3%}}@media (max-width:767px){.secure-program{padding:0 16px}}.secure-program__tabs{margin:48px 0}@media (max-width:767px){.secure-program__tabs{margin-bottom:0}}.secure-program__tabs .ui-select{padding-top:0}.secure-program__tabs .ui-select .q-icon svg{color:#ff9549}.secure-program__tabs .ui-select .q-field__inner{border-bottom:2px solid #ff9549}.secure-program__tabs .ui-select .q-field__control{background-color:transparent!important;border:none!important}.secure-program__tabs .ui-select .q-field__control:after{display:none!important}.secure-program__tabs .ui-select .q-field__native{color:#fff;font-size:16px;font-weight:500;line-height:150%}.secure-program .q-tabs__content{justify-content:center}.secure-program .q-tab-panels{margin-left:0!important;margin-right:0!important;margin-top:32px}@media (max-width:1023px){.secure-program .q-tab-panels{overflow:visible}}.secure-program .q-tab-panels .q-panel{overflow:hidden}@media (max-width:1023px){.secure-program .q-tab-panels .q-panel{overflow:visible}}.secure-program .q-tab{border-bottom:2px solid #3d4545;padding:18px 32px;width:100%}@media (max-width:767px){.secure-program .q-tab{padding:18px 10px}}.secure-program .q-tab .title-span{font-size:16px;font-weight:500;line-height:20px;text-transform:none}@media (max-width:1390px){.secure-program .q-tab .title-span{white-space:normal}}.secure-program .q-tab__indicator{background:#ff9549;bottom:-2px;height:4px}.secure-program .q-tab-panels{background:unset}.secure-program .q-tab-panels .bullet-list{align-items:stretch;gap:24px}@media (max-width:1025px){.secure-program .q-tab-panels .bullet-list{gap:16px}}.secure-program .q-tab-panels .bullet-list li{padding-left:0}.secure-program .content-block{align-items:flex-start;-moz-column-gap:72px;column-gap:72px;display:flex;justify-content:center}@media (max-width:767px){.secure-program .content-block{flex-direction:column;row-gap:32px}}.secure-program .content-block .block{max-width:384px;width:100%}.secure-program .content-block .block .q-img{min-height:12.5vw}@media (max-width:767px){.secure-program .content-block .block{max-width:100%}.secure-program .content-block .block .q-img{min-height:57.3333333333vw}}.secure-program .content-block .block .auto-title{color:#fff;font-size:24px;font-weight:500;line-height:28px;margin-bottom:24px}.secure-program .content-block .block table{overflow:hidden}.secure-program .content-block .block table tbody tr{height:auto!important}.secure-program .content-block .block table tbody tr td{width:13.6%!important}.secure-program .content-block .block table tbody tr td:first-child{width:32%!important}.secure-program .content-block .block table tbody tr:first-child *,.secure-program .content-block .block table tbody tr:first-child td{border:none;color:#8e9595;font-size:13px;font-weight:500;line-height:16px;margin:0;padding:4px 0}.secure-program .content-block .block table tbody tr:first-child * p,.secure-program .content-block .block table tbody tr:first-child td p{padding:0}.secure-program .content-block .block table tbody tr *,.secure-program .content-block .block table tbody tr td{border:none;color:#fff;font-size:20px;font-weight:300;height:auto!important;line-height:30px;margin:0;padding:4px 0}.secure-program .content-block .block table tbody tr * p,.secure-program .content-block .block table tbody tr td p{padding:0}.secure-program .content-block .block p{border-top:1px solid #2f3838;color:#d4d9d9;font-size:14px;font-weight:300;line-height:20px;margin-top:8px;padding:12px 0}
